MUNICIPAL SOCIAL WELFARE AND DEVELOPMENT OFFICE

ISSUANCE OF CERTIFICATE OF INDIGENCY

A. ABOUT THE SERVICE

Certificate of Indigency is issued to less fortunate resident who desires to avail assistance such
as Scholarship, Medical Services, Free Legal Aid from Public Attorney’s Office (PAO) and the like.

B. WHO CAN AVAIL OF THE SERVICE

Any bonafide indigent resident of La Trinidad, Benguet

C. REQUIREMENTS

1. Barangay certification
2. Certificate of No Property (for PAO Assistance)

D.AVAILABILITY OF THE SERVICE

MONDAY TO FRIDAY
8:00 am to 5:00 pm
NO NOON BREAK

ISSUANCE OF PRE-MARRIAGE CERTIFICATE

A. ABOUT THE SERVICE

Pre-Marriage Certificate is issued to would be couples as pre-requisite for securing marriage


license in accordance with Presidential Decree 965 and Article 16 of the Family Code of the Philippines.

B. WHO CAN AVAIL OF THE SERVICE

18 years old and above and a resident of the municipality.

C. REQUIREMENT

Would be couple must be 18 years old and above

D.AVAILABILITY OF THE SERVICE

TUESDAYS & THURDAYS


1:00 Pm to 5:00 pm

ISSUANCE OF SOLO PARENT’S IDENTIFICATION CARD (ID)

A. ABOUT THE SERVICE

Issuance of ID to a Solo Parent to enjoy and avail of the benefits and privileges as provided for
under the Implementing Rules and Regulations of Republic Act No.8972.

B. WHO CAN AVAIL OF THE SERVICE

Any bonafide resident of La Trinidad, Benguet who are “Solo parent" - any individual who falls under any
of the following categories:
(1) A woman who gives birth as a result of rape and other crimes against chastity even without a final
conviction of the offender: Provided, That the mother keeps and raises the child;
(2) Parent left solo or alone with the responsibility of parenthood due to death of spouse;
(3) Parent left solo or alone with the responsibility of parenthood while the spouse is detained or is
serving sentence for a criminal conviction for at least one (1) year;
(4) Parent left solo or alone with the responsibility of parenthood due to physical and/or mental incapacity
of spouse as certified by a public medical practitioner;
(5) Parent left solo or alone with the responsibility of parenthood due to legal separation or de fact
separation from spouse for at least one (1) year, as long as he/she is entrusted with the custody of the
children;
(6) Parent left solo or alone with the responsibility of parenthood due to declaration of nullity or annulment
of marriage as decreed by a court or by a church as long as he/she is entrusted with the custody of the
children;
(7) Parent left solo or alone with the responsibility of parenthood due to abandonment of spouse for at
least one (1) year;
(8) Unmarried mother/father who has preferred to keep and rear her/his child/children instead of having
others care for them or give them up to a welfare institution;
(9) Any other person who solely provides parental care and support to a child or children;
(10) Any family member who assumes the responsibility of head of family as a result of the death,
abandonment, disappearance or prolonged absence of the parents or solo parent.
A change in the status or circumstance of the parent claiming benefits under this Act, such that he/she is
no longer left alone with the responsibility of parenthood, shall terminate his/her eligibility for these
benefits

C. REQUIREMENTS

1. Barangay Certificate of Residency


2. Xerox Copy of Birth Certificate of Children ages 0-17
3. 2 copies 1x1 ID Picture
4. Death Certificate (if widowed)

D.AVAILABILITY OF THE SERVICE

MONDAY TO FRIDAY

8:00 am to 5:00 pm
NO NOON BREAK

ISSUANCE OF SOCIAL CASE STUDY REPORT

A. ABOUT THE SERVICE

Provision of medical/financial assistance to individual or family in crisis situation.

B. WHO CAN AVAIL OF THE SERVICE

Any bonafide resident of La Trinidad, Benguet who are in need of financial assistance and
diagnosed with cancer, end stage renal diseases, heart ailments and the like.

C. REQUIREMENTS

1. Personal Letter to the Honorable Mayor


2. Barangay certification of residency
3. Medical Abstract or Certificate with signature over printed name of doctor and licensed number
4. Statement of account duly signed by the billing officer for individual seeking hospitalization assistance
with corresponding promissory note to prove the unpaid hospital billing.
5. Treatment protocol and costing of treatment for chemotherapy and hemodialysis cases
6. Costing of procedures for laboratory or special procedures like CT scan, MRI and the like with the
hospital acceptance letter.

PROVISION OF EMERGENCY ASSISTANT

A. ABOUT THE SERVICE

Provision of timely and appropriate response to help alleviate the conditions of


distressed/displaced individuals/families who are victims of disaster and are in need of food, clothing,
temporary shelter and other emergency requirements through the efficient and effective provision of mass
feeding and or financial/material assistance.

B. WHO CAN AVAIL OF THE SERVICE

Any bonafide resident of La Trinidad, Benguet who are victims of natural and man - made
disasters, evacuees/victims of social conflict, ejected, newly resettled squatters and stranded and
individuals/families in crisis situation

C. REQUIREMENT

1. Secure Certificate of residency specifying that client is a victim of man-made/natural disaster from
the Punong Barangay
2. MSWDO staff conducts interview and assessment
3. Report from concerned agency about the disaster ex. Certification from the BFP if fire related
incident.
